課程
/前端開發
/JavaScript
/JavaScript進階篇
我剛學js,也不知道這樣寫有沒有語法問題,歡迎大神指點
2019-01-14
源自:JavaScript進階篇 3-8
正在回答
沒有,只是你的a數組沒有var定義,這樣不好。
因為在你給a[0]賦值的時候是賦值的字符串。字符串本身就是可以加的。
就好像你的document.write(a[i]+"<br/><br/>");
它就是把a[i]字符串加上"<br/><br/>",變成一個新的字符串,然后傳給HTML代碼里面運行。
而字符串也只能加,其他算術是不行的。
慕仔1561325 提問者
Fidel_Yiu 回復 慕仔1561325 提問者
慕仔1561325 提問者 回復 Fidel_Yiu
舉報
本課程從如何插入JS代碼開始,帶您進入網頁動態交互世界
1 回答發現不用數組也可以
1 回答偶然發現,這段代碼怎么可以讀出來
3 回答用 && 邏輯運算符 篩選一次也可以吧
2 回答我用的是函數,也可以用switch case實現
2 回答最簡潔的代碼,可以參考一下!
Copyright ? 2025 imooc.com All Rights Reserved | 京ICP備12003892號-11 京公網安備11010802030151號
購課補貼聯系客服咨詢優惠詳情
慕課網APP您的移動學習伙伴
掃描二維碼關注慕課網微信公眾號
2019-01-14
沒有,只是你的a數組沒有var定義,這樣不好。
因為在你給a[0]賦值的時候是賦值的字符串。字符串本身就是可以加的。
就好像你的document.write(a[i]+"<br/><br/>");
它就是把a[i]字符串加上"<br/><br/>",變成一個新的字符串,然后傳給HTML代碼里面運行。
而字符串也只能加,其他算術是不行的。